Media Relations and Crisis Management Conference
November 17, 2011
Solution Center, Durham

It’s no secret that communication is a critical part of your business.  Media interviews, crisis communications and social media all play a pivotal role in influencing your public image and marketing your company.  This inaugural event tied it all together and provided how your company should prepare, react and interpret these issues in today's world.
